The Iron Duke
Proper British cooking in a listed Victorian building on Royal Exchange Square — no pretence, just excellent food and real ale.

You're walking into one of Glasgow's most handsome squares, and The Iron Duke sits right there in a grand red sandstone conversion. It's the kind of place that feels like it's always been here, all original cornicing and period detail, but the vibe is refreshingly unpretentious. The menu reads like a love letter to British ingredients done right — think slow-braised meats, proper pies, seasonal vegetables that taste like something. Service moves at the right pace, unhurried but attentive, and the drinks list leans into quality Scottish spirits and well-chosen wines alongside proper cask ales. This is where locals actually eat when they want proper food without the fuss.
